Australian Red Cross is part of the world’s largest humanitarian organisation. As an organisation independent of government and with no political, religious or cultural affiliation, our vision is human dignity, peace, safety and well-being for all.
Our purpose is supporting and empowering people and communities in times of vulnerability, preventing and alleviating suffering across Australian and internationally through mobilising the power of humanity.
Our focus is on building an active movement of people united by a shared commitment to humanitarian values; empowering everyone to do what's most needed in their communities, leveraging Red Cross' resources and expertise to build a hopeful and exciting future.
As the Director, you will lead our work to deliver on our operational and strategic priorities. You will provide leadership, effective change management and ensure positive internal and external stakeholder relationships including working actively with the SA Divisional Advisory Board and building our member and volunteer base in SA.
As part of the organisation’s senior leadership, you will help us deliver financial sustainability and positively position Red Cross externally. You will also deliver disaster preparedness, response and recovery initiatives in the State.
